Raspberry Chocolate Triangles

List of Ingredients
1 1/2 cups Flour
3/4 cup Sugar
1 cup softened Butter (not margarine)
1 box frozen Red Raspberries
1/4 cup Orange Juice
1 Tbsp. Corn Starch
3/4 cup Miniature Semi-Chocolate Chips
Vanilla Chips (Optional)
Recipe
Heat oven to 350 degrees F.
Mix flour, sugar and softened butter. Press into an ungreased 9 x 13-inch pan and bake for 15 minutes. Thaw berries and strain 2 or 3 times to get the seeds out. Pour juice from the berries into a small pan. Add orange juice and corn starch. Heat to boiling, stirring constantly, until thickened. Cool for 10 minutes. Sprinkle the chocolate chips over the crust. (Be sure to use miniatures.) Spoon raspberry mixture over the chocolate chips and spread carefully.
Bake for 20 minutes or until the raspberry mixture is set. Refrigerate until chocolate is firm. Drizzle with melted vanilla chips if you want to. (I don't). Cut into 3-inch squares. Cut each square into 4 triangles.
